    • @Heurigijdbd
      @Heurigijdbd 5 หลายเดือนก่อน +2

      Lossless is meant for people who listen with hi-fi setups, like for example open back headphones running with a dac and amp setup. Using earbuds to listen to lossless is pointless, you won’t notice the difference. Especially not with bluetooth, bluetooth forces you to compress the audio, making it impossible to have lossless audio through bluetooth.
